Synopsis:

Similar to dance clubs around the world Vincente's is a restaurant with room for dancing. Jorge Gomez starts with a salsa performance and then gives a beginner lesson. Vincente's is a great place to get a group together or take a date for dinner and dancing. Beginners are especially welcome and those brand new to salsa. This is a relaxed environment to learn the basic steps.

Vincente's Disappointment

I went to Vicente’s Friday, December 14, 2007. I t has been a while since I had visited. I was looking forward to a new Salsa experience as well as having dinner. I did not have to wait for a table, Great. Water was served, Wonderful. I was sitting with my friend and talking taking in the sites. Chatter was loud but people seemed to be enjoying themselves. It seemed as if there was going to be a late start for the dance lesson and music. I thought ok that will give us time to enjoy a little food. That is if our server would come to take our order. Finally some one came over to ask if our order had been taken. We told them no. The waitperson said he would find our server. A few minutes later (about 3/5 min) the wait person returned to say our wait person would be over shortly. I told him not to bother we were leaving. We had been waiting for about 20/30 min. As we were leaving the Hostesses commented on us leaving so soon, we told them we had not been served. Both of their mouths dropped open. They could not believe it. I asked to speak with the manager. One of the young ladies called him. As we were waiting some people came in and asked if anyone had seen Debbie Stabenow because someone was looking for her. The Manager finally decided to show up. I expressed my disappointment and all I got from him was excuses. “We cut our wait staff so people are confused as to what area they are handling" "It's Friday and we are busy" etc....... never once” I'm sorry for your inconvience" or apology. His whole attitude and demeanor said I really don't care about you and I'll just get more customers to take you place. I guess we were just not important enough. This experience has left a bad taste in my mouth. I will definitely have to think more then twice about returning to Vincente’s.
